Usage

Azulfidine (Sulfasalazine) is used to treat a certain type of bowel disease called ulcerative colitis. This medication does not cure this condition, but it helps decrease symptoms such as fever, stomach pain, diarrhea, and rectal bleeding. After an attack is treated, sulfasalazine is also used to increase the amount of time between attacks. This medication works by reducing irritation and swelling in the large intestines. In addition, delayed-release tablets of sulfasalazine are used to treat rheumatoid arthritis. Sulfasalazine helps to reduce joint pain, swelling, and stiffness. Early treatment of rheumatoid arthritis with sulfasalazine helps to reduce/prevent further joint damage so you can do more of your normal daily activities. This medication is used with other drugs, rest, and physical therapy in patients who have not responded to other medications. Azulfidine is not approved for use by anyone younger than 2 years old.

Side Effects and Precautions

The common Azulfidine side effects may include rash, low sperm count in men, stomach upset, headache, dizziness, unusual tiredness, change in color of skin and urine, loss of appetite, nausea, and vomiting.

Seek emergency medical attention if you have symptoms of a heart attack or an allergic reaction. Call your doctor right away if you have any of the serious side effects such as:
• Hearing changes (ringing in the ears);
• Liver problems;
• Mental/mood changes;
• New lump/growth in the neck;
• Numbness/tingling of hands/feet;
• Puffy eyes, weight gain;
• Signs of low blood sugar;
• Signs of kidney problems

Warnings and Interactions

Do not use Azulfidine if you:
• A blockage in your bladder or intestines;
• Are allergic to sulfa drugs, aspirin, or similar medicines called salicylates;
• Have porphyria (a genetic enzyme disorder that causes symptoms affecting the skin or nervous system)

Tell your doctor if you have ever had:
• Asthma;
• Blood disorders or low blood cell counts;
• Frequent infections;
• Liver or kidney disease

Tell your doctor if you are pregnant. Taking Azulfidine can make it harder for your body to absorb folic acid, and folic acid helps prevent major birth defects of the baby's brain or spine. You may need to take folic acid supplements if you take this medicine during pregnancy. Sulfasalazine can pass into breast milk and may cause diarrhea or bloody stools in a nursing baby. Tell your doctor if you are breast-feeding. This medication can temporarily affect fertility in males. Ask your doctor for more details. This drug may make you dizzy. Alcohol can make you dizzier. Do not drive, use machinery, or do anything that needs alertness until you can do it safely. Limit alcoholic beverages. This medication may make you more sensitive to the sun. Limit your time in the sun. Use sunscreen and wear protective clothing when outdoors. Get medical help right away if you get sunburned or have skin blisters/redness. This medication is similar to aspirin. Children and teenagers should not take aspirin or aspirin-related medications (e.g., salicylates) if they have chickenpox, flu, or any undiagnosed illness, or if they have just been given a live virus vaccine, without first consulting a doctor. Other drugs may affect Azulfidine, including prescription and over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al products. Tell your doctor about all your current medicines and any medicine you start or stop using. Some products that may interact with this drug include: digoxin, folic acid, methenamine, PABA taken by mouth. Sulfasalazine is very similar to mesalamine. Do not use mesalamine medications taken by mouth while using sulfasalazine.
